The word ‘unidentified’ is key.

The Pentagon officially released

three videos of Unidentified Aerial

Phenomena [UAP] confirming the

footage taken by U.S. Navy fighter-jets

was authentic. This is the first time in

history the Department of Defense has

officially acknowledged the existence

of Unidentified Aerial Phenomena.

The videos were originally

released by TTSA in 2017 by The

New York Times and subsequently

confirmed by the Navy. The Pentagon

has also previously acknowledged the

existence of an Advanced Aerospace

Threat Identification Program

[AATIP] formerly run by Luis Elizondo.

Elizondo now serves as the Director of

Government Programs & Services for

TTSA.

Be Careful With Conspiracy Theories During

Grand, World-Changing Events

Judy Mikovits, Ph.D., and disgraced scientist has found a new way to

become lucrative - conspiracy theories.

Andrew Perry

Let me tell you the story about

how a disgruntled scientist became a

leading contributor to a coronavirus

conspiracy theory, and how it bodes as

a warning for all of us.

Judy Mikovits, Ph.D., was once a

reputable scientist.

She was the research director for

the Whittemore Peterson Institute,

where she and coworkers were trying

to find the cause of Chronic Fatigue

Syndrome, or CFS.

In 2007, she met one of the

discoverers of a retrovirus called

xenotropic murine leukemia virusrelated

virus (which I will thankfully

refer to as XMRV hereafter).

That meeting apparently really

influenced her, because after she

discovered two CFS patients in 2008

who tested positive for XMRV, she and

her coworkers published a paper in the

journal Science suggesting that XMRV

has a causal role in CFS.

This attracted a lot of attention,

but every attempt by scientists

afterwards to replicate her findings

failed. Eventually, the journal Science

retracted the paper.

Cypress, California is an Orange

County suburb, part of the Greater Los

Angeles area. Roadrunners are native

to the region, but are usually only found

in the wild, and in open spaces where

they can run freely.

Imagine the surprise when Cypress

residents, and those in surrounding

areas, discovered roadrunners in their

neighborhood.

A Facebook group called Cypress

Community Group (original) first

started reporting roadrunner sightings

on April 23. Resident Daniel Rodriguez

posted a photo and a question: “Y’all

ever see a roadrunner in Cypress?”

After that post, several other

residents began reporting roadrunners

too, in an area covering a three square

mile radius.

Nancy Canyon, a bird expert from

the Orange County Audubon Society

based in nearby Newport Beach, said

she has no idea why the roadrunners

are making an appearance in Cypress.

Cypress isn’t particularly known for

large open fields or wild lands, which is

where roadrunners flourish.

“They are native to the region, but

in a place with a lot of residential that is

very unusual,” said Canyon. “They prefer

wide open spaces.”

In Newport Beach, where there are

several large preserves, roadrunners

have seen an increase.

“Last year we got a few roadrunners,

but this year there are plenty. I’m not

sure why.”

One possibility is that with the

sudden spurt in the roadrunner

population, they’ve spread out into

surrounding areas, and so far Cypress

residents are just the first to have

noticed, and they just eat food waste

along with their usual diet.

“They usually just eat lizards and

insects. But really, roadrunners will eat

just about anything,” said Canyon.

Twitch Upon A Star

Tammye McDuff

One of the most beloved characters

of my childhood was Elizabeth

Montgomery’s portrayal of Samantha

Stevens in the 1960’s sitcom Bewitched.

I have vivid memories of spending

hours in front of the mirror trying

to twitch my nose like she did, to no

avail. When I interviewed biographer,

writer and producer Herbie J. Pilato,

and discovered that he wrote the

popular book ‘Twitch Upon A Star: The

Bewitched Life and Career of Elizabeth

Montgomery’ I knew TCTN had to

spotlight the author and his book.

“When I first met Elizabeth

Montgomery, I wanted to write

a reunion movie for Bewitched.

Montgomery declined the movie but

agreed to the book. I always knew

in the back of mind that I wanted to

write her life story. She was a very

interesting and generous person. She

was down to earth and unaffected

by the whole Hollywood scene,” began

Pilato.

Her father was Robert

Montgomery who was an American

film and television actor and producer

with numerous credits to his name

from 1929 to 1960. His most memorable

credit was ‘Robert Montgomery

Presents’ which was an early version of

the Twilight Zone. Elizabeth made her

television debut on the series. “I was

compelled to write about Elizabeth,

I guess you can say I was bewitched,”

laughs Pilato.

Montgomery did a movie called

‘Johnny Cool’ with William Asher, “It

was disdain at first site but then they

eventually fell in love and got married.

He was not a great drama director but

was a fantastic comedy director. He

introduced ‘Our Miss Brooks’; began

directing ‘I Love Lucy’ and ‘The Patti

Duke Show’ then finally produced and

directed ‘Bewitched’.

Asher’s initial idea was to write

a story about a fun couple with the

storyline about a wealthy woman who

fell in love with a garage mechanic. But

a plot twist was introduced. Instead of

a rich woman ‘rich-craft’ falling for a

regular guy, a witch falls for a mortal.

The studio loved it and the sitcom was

born.

At the time, ABC was a young

network and they were willing to

try different things. “It was also

the 1960’s and those times were

filled with race wars and riots and

unpleasant things like that, and

‘Bewitched’ was an entertainment

escape,” said Pilato. “People fell in

love with Elizabeth. It wasn’t really

a show about a witch; it was a show

about a person, who happened to be

a witch. The relationship was about

the love between the two characters

irrespective of their differences. It was

about true love.”

When we first arrived at The Art

Theatre in Long Beach, my wife Stephanie

and I did not know what to expect. We

were about to watch The Rocky Horror

Picture Show (RHPS), put on by an acting

troupe called Midnight Insanity. We

were ‘virgins’, according to the Midnight

Insanity staff. In fact, they even drew a big

red ‘V’ on our cheeks, to distinguish us as

such.

This made us prime targets for what

was about to happen.

The Virgin Experience

Before the showing (which is always

at midnight) there was a competition

that two lucky virgins would have to

participate in. And lucky me, for at the

time I was one of those virgins. The MC

chose me. Well, my wife technically made

several gestures towards me which

prompted him.

The DJ asked the virgins which cast

member we wanted to ’play with’. The MC,

noticing I was unfamiliar with the cast,

suggested that I choose someone named

‘Glitter Tits’, or maybe it was ‘Sparkle Tits’. I

assume she was playing the character of

Columbia from the movie.

Contrary to what some might

believe, the cast is not all transvestites

nor transsexuals. A full figured woman

approached me. This was Sparkle Tits!

The other virgin was a young brunette,

and she picked another woman.

The virgins were directed to get

on our knees. To my dismay, I knew at

this point where this was going. Sparkle

Managing Editor Andrew Perry in the middle, flanked by the cast of

Midnight Insanity.

Tits took out a banana and placed it at

her crotch. The Master of Ceremonies

explained that the competition was

basically who can eat the banana the

fastest.

Sparkle Tits grabbed some hair from

the back of my head, and I said a quick

rationalization in my head, “Hey, it’s all in

good fun. She’s a woman. Whatevs.”

So, I started eating the banana. It

didn’t help that the audience started

taunting me. Some annoying guy in the

audience was saying corny lines like, “Good

sluts don’t spit” and “Take it all in, baby”.

Meanwhile, I’m just trying to eat a banana.

Well, to my horror, I won that contest.

I sheepishly grinned and raised my arms

in victory. The MC presented a basket,

from which I could pick a prize. Again,

lucky me, I pulled out a copy of a Blu Ray

movie rendition of Ayn Rand’s Atlas

Shrugged. If you know me, Ayn Rand is

almost the complete opposite.

My Impression of the Show

So that was my virgin experience. But

how was the show?

I won’t spoil it, but if you’ve seen the

classic movie, that movie is basically

playing in the background, while

the Midnight Insanity cast act it out

on the stage in front of the screen.

Simultaneously, the audience recited

a series of lines timed to the movie. I

suspect these were passed along “orally”,

but I wouldn’t be surprised if there was a

script.

The best way I can describe it: it’s as if

someone’s Freudian Id went out of control

after watching a movie a hundred times,

and that Id manifested itself through

loud outbursts of curse words and

naughty jokes, while occasionally pulling

out random props that tangentially went

along with the movie.

It was definitely very immersive.

There are even parts where water

drizzles from the ceiling during the rainy

scene of the movie. Prior to the movie, we

were given an option to purchase a small

bag with a bunch of props, either for

noise, or to throw, or to cover yourself in

the event of rain.

The dancing and carrying on was

very entertaining to watch. One of the

women, very voluptuous, even stripped

topless, except for pastees over her

nipples. Another funny point involved

the character Rocky, portrayed as a man

wearing nothing but golden shorts. At

this particular show, I think the person

playing him was actually gay, but he had a

few scenes with women. And he was very

vocal in his displeasure.

Coven-made Chicken Pot Pie

By Frankie Fronk

Ingredients

1 pre-made pie shell [for base]

1 flat pastry sheet [for top]

1/2 cup white wine, dry

1 clove of garlic

1 cup of chopped celery

1 cup of stringed carrots

1/2- cup frozen peas [keep frozen

till you add to mix]

1 ½ cups of heavy whipping cream

2 cups cubed chicken [no bones

or skin]

1/2 cup of chicken broth [or 4

bouillon cubes]

2 egg yolks beaten [set aside as

egg wash]

1/2 cup melted unsalted butter

2 sprigs of thyme

2 sprigs of rosemary

1/2 table spoon of tarragon

Fresh basil

Directions (Pre heat oven to

400 degrees)

Put chicken chunks in pan on

medium heat and brown - add

garlic, thyme, and basil, carrots,

celery, peas. Add dry white wine

and let reduce about four minutes.

Once reduced - add salt and

pepper to taste.

While that cooks down start

your cream sauce.

Add chicken broth, heavy

whipping cream and tarragon.

As sauce starts to heat up, start

slowly adding sifted white flour

using a whisk until sauce thickens.

Once the sauce is at a consistency

like gravy add the contents to the

chicken mixture and set aside.

In a pie pan take your pie base

and add contents of pan

to the pie making sure

you don’t over fill (make

little under level) then use

the melted butter and

brush it onto the seam of

the pie crust.

Insert the top or

crown of the pie making

sure you cut of any extra

dough and crinkle the

sides to hold.

Use the egg wash to

coat the top of the crust.

Add a couple sprigs of

thyme to the top of pie

before putting it in the

oven. As an extra touch

use the pastry scraps

to put your initials or

whatever on top of the

pie.

Frank Fronk

Bake for 25 minutes checking it

every once in awhile to make sure

you don’t burn it.

Once golden brown take out of

oven and let stand for 15 minutes

and then enjoy.
